How do you calculate 95th percentile in SQL?

Contents

How is percentile calculated in SQL?

The PERCENT_RANK function in SQL Server calculates the relative rank SQL Percentile of each row. It always returns values greater than 0, and the highest value is 1. It does not count any NULL values. This function is nondeterministic.

How do you calculate 95th percentile?

To calculate the 95th percentile, multiply the number of entries (K) by 0.95: 0.95 x 5 = 4.75 (let’s call this result N).

How do you find the 90th percentile in SQL?

1. In SQL server 2012, the new suite of analytic functions are introduced. …
2. SELECT DISTINCT.
3. [Month],
4. Mean = AVG(Score) OVER (PARTITION BY [Month]),
5. StdDev = STDEV(Score) OVER (PARTITION BY [Month]),
6. P90 = PERCENTILE_CONT(0.9) WITHIN GROUP (ORDER BY Score) OVER (PARTITION BY [Month])
7. FROM my_table.

What is a percentile score?

A percentile is a comparison score between a particular score and the scores of the rest of a group. It shows the percentage of scores that a particular score surpassed. For example, if you score 75 points on a test, and are ranked in the 85 th percentile, it means that the score 75 is higher than 85% of the scores.

IMPORTANT:  Question: How do I make data vertical in SQL?

What is the percentile formula?

Key Facts: Percentiles

Percentiles can be calculated using the formula n = (P/100) x N, where P = percentile, N = number of values in a data set (sorted from smallest to largest), and n = ordinal rank of a given value. Percentiles are frequently used to understand test scores and biometric measurements.

Is 95th percentile good or bad?

A 95th percentile says that 95% of the time data points are below that value and 5% of the time they are above that value. 95 is a magic number used in networking because you have to plan for the most-of-the-time case.

How do you find the 90th percentile with mean and standard deviation?

Percentile Z
95th 1.645

What is 95th percentile height?

What falling on the 95th percentile of a pediatric growth chart means is that your baby is currently both taller and heavier than 95 percent of all other babies her age (of the same sex).

What is 90th percentile?

If you know that your score is in the 90th percentile, that means you scored better than 90% of people who took the test. Percentiles are commonly used to report scores in tests, like the SAT, GRE and LSAT. … That means if you scored 156 on the exam, your score was better than 70 percent of test takers.

How do you find the percentile in Bigquery?

To get percentiles, simply ask for 100 quantiles. select percentiles[offset(10)] as p10, percentiles[offset(25)] as p25, percentiles[offset(50)] as p50, percentiles[offset(75)] as p75, percentiles[offset(90)] as p90, from ( select approx_quantiles(char_length(text), 100) percentiles from `bigquery-public-data.

How do you calculate the percentage of a snowflake?

Snowflake does not have a function named PERCENTAGE , but it does have a function named RATIO_TO_REPORT , which divides the value in the current row by the sum of the values in all of the rows in a window.

IMPORTANT:  What is REST API in node JS?

Is 86th percentile good?

If your test score is in the 86th percentile, it means that you scored better than 86 percent of all the test takers. It also means that 14 percent scored the same or better than you.

Is the 95th percentile the top 5?

The 95th percentile is a number that is greater than 95% of the numbers in a given set. … This 95th percentile is the highest value left when the top 5% of a numerically sorted set of collected data is discarded.

Is 95th percentile good for weight?

There’s a big range of normal on the chart: Anyone who falls between the 5th percentile and the 85th percentile is a healthy weight. If someone is at or above the 85th percentile line on the chart (but less than the 95th percentile), doctors consider that person overweight.